Output c688af83bed54bc6d4c348df23bd95a7c9b5e30eb5067103801813a1c7db2d59:1

value
20321860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a307982bdcb5ed694894afd0368b1fcdde2a9732 OP_EQUALVERIFY OP_CHECKSIG
address
1Fs2EwPxupHVsSZwu2dL1yAqgwbcV9KS3r
transaction
c688af83bed54bc6d4c348df23bd95a7c9b5e30eb5067103801813a1c7db2d59
confirmations
474287
spent
true